MARK WIGLEYIn the fifth episode of our podcast series we discuss Mark Wigley's lecture "The Human Insect: Antenna Architectures 1887-2017" at the HNI in Rotterdam, regarding the massive integration of technology in our everyday life, and the history of radio in combination with architecture since 1887. This interview was recorded during the ARGUS “Night of Philosophy” event in 2016 at the New Institute in Rotterdam. Richard Sennett shares his thoughts on how people with different cultures experience the same built environment, proposing diverse solutions on how architects could improve community participation in the design process.
